App chip refactor
- Adds background outline replacing 2 circles + rect approach. This enables easier shadow drawing code. - Simplify structure of AppChipView. - Adds an anchor View to simplify laying out of menu around app chip Bug: 313644427 Bug: 317007147 Fix: 322760765 Flag: ACONFIG com.android.launcher3.enable_grid_only_overview TEAMFOOD Flag: ACONFIG com.android.launcher3.enable_overview_icon_menu TEAMFOOD Test: OverviewImageTest Change-Id: I56c2644779863c083ae475a740a84321b1d0c396
This commit is contained in:
@@ -260,7 +260,6 @@ public class DeviceProfile {
|
||||
public int overviewTaskIconSizePx;
|
||||
public int overviewTaskIconDrawableSizePx;
|
||||
public int overviewTaskIconDrawableSizeGridPx;
|
||||
public int overviewTaskIconAppChipMenuDrawableSizePx;
|
||||
public int overviewTaskThumbnailTopMarginPx;
|
||||
public final int overviewActionsHeight;
|
||||
public final int overviewActionsTopMarginPx;
|
||||
@@ -686,8 +685,6 @@ public class DeviceProfile {
|
||||
res.getDimensionPixelSize(R.dimen.task_thumbnail_icon_drawable_size);
|
||||
overviewTaskIconDrawableSizeGridPx =
|
||||
res.getDimensionPixelSize(R.dimen.task_thumbnail_icon_drawable_size_grid);
|
||||
overviewTaskIconAppChipMenuDrawableSizePx = res.getDimensionPixelSize(
|
||||
R.dimen.task_thumbnail_icon_menu_drawable_size);
|
||||
overviewTaskThumbnailTopMarginPx =
|
||||
enableOverviewIconMenu() ? 0 : overviewTaskIconSizePx + overviewTaskMarginPx;
|
||||
// Don't add margin with floating search bar to minimize risk of overlapping.
|
||||
@@ -2163,8 +2160,6 @@ public class DeviceProfile {
|
||||
overviewTaskIconDrawableSizePx));
|
||||
writer.println(prefix + pxToDpStr("overviewTaskIconDrawableSizeGridPx",
|
||||
overviewTaskIconDrawableSizeGridPx));
|
||||
writer.println(prefix + pxToDpStr("overviewTaskIconAppChipMenuDrawableSizePx",
|
||||
overviewTaskIconAppChipMenuDrawableSizePx));
|
||||
writer.println(prefix + pxToDpStr("overviewTaskThumbnailTopMarginPx",
|
||||
overviewTaskThumbnailTopMarginPx));
|
||||
writer.println(prefix + pxToDpStr("overviewActionsTopMarginPx",
|
||||
|
||||
Reference in New Issue
Block a user